The song we’re looking at is off of their incredibly successful “American Idiot” album and is the first track off of it. This is quite a fast track, clocking in at 176 beats per minute, but because the rhythms are all quarter and eighth notes, it’s quite easy to play.
"Goodbye" covers a 20 bar solo over a punk/rock progression. The first aim of demonstration is some simple, yet effective pentatonic ideas and extra note choice. Another highlight is how to build your solo through "gears", building up to the fast flashy stuff, which is essential for a coherent & interesting structure
